AN INLAID, PART-EBONISED AND MAPLE BURRWOOD CABINET
DESIGNED BY JOSEPH MARIA OLBRICH, CIRCA 1905
the cabinet doors enclosing fitted interior, supported by pillaster supports, the whole finely inlaid with mother-of-pearl and banded with ebonised reeding
55in. (139.7cm.) width
Literature
Cf: Ein Dokument Deutscher Kunst, Darmstadt 1901-1976, Vol. 4, Die Künstler der Mathildenhohe, Exhibition Catalogue Mathildenhohe Darmstadt, Darmstadt, 1977, pp. 168-169, Cat. No. 470 (cabinet from the same series illustrated)
